Why Consider Advancing Your Teaching Career?

The rewards of teaching are immense—from witnessing students’ “aha!” moments to inspiring their curiosity and shaping the future. However, for those looking to expand their impact and explore diverse careers in education, there are even more reasons to consider advancing their teaching career:

Leadership Opportunities

Move beyond the classroom and influence the entire school environment. Consider roles like Department Head, Grade Level Chair, or even Principal. These positions offer a broader platform to shape educational practices and foster a positive learning atmosphere. These leadership roles also provide opportunities to contribute to curriculum development, implement school-wide initiatives, mentor other teachers, and create a positive and collaborative school culture that benefits everyone.

Enhanced Earning Potential

Investing in your professional development through additional qualifications and experience can significantly enhance your earning potential. As you gain expertise and assume greater responsibilities, you can command a higher salary, reflecting your increased value within the educational sector. This increased financial stability not only rewards your dedication and hard work but also provides greater financial security for you and your family.

Specialized Expertise

Deepen your knowledge in a specific subject area or instructional approach. These specializations not only enhance your own professional skills but also make you a valuable asset to your school community, enabling you to share your expertise and mentor other educators.

Career Flexibility

Advancing your teaching career can open doors to a wider range of opportunities within the educational sector, providing greater career flexibility. You can explore roles like curriculum specialist, working at the district or regional level to develop and implement effective curricula. These positions allow you to leverage your teaching experience in new and impactful ways, supporting educators and contributing to the broader educational landscape.

Become a Mentor

Share your knowledge and experience with new teachers by becoming a mentor or coach. This not only benefits your colleagues but also allows you to hone the very skills a teacher should have to excel in the profession, such as effective communication, strong leadership, and deep pedagogical understanding, through reflection and collaborative practice.

Embrace Leadership Roles

Volunteer for committees or take on additional responsibilities within your school. This demonstrates your initiative and leadership potential, showcasing your willingness to go the extra mile.

For example, you could volunteer for the curriculum development committee, the school improvement team, or organize extracurricular activities. These experiences provide valuable opportunities to develop organizational, collaborative, and problem-solving skills.

Consider leading a professional learning community (PLC) focused on a specific subject area or instructional approach, such as differentiated instruction, project-based learning, or literacy development. Leading a PLC allows you to facilitate peer learning, share best practices, and contribute to the professional growth of your colleagues, further demonstrating your leadership capabilities.
